Today, we'll look at some natural remedies to lower fever at home. Having a fever is a cause for concern. Fever doesn't always mean a serious health problem, but it does indicate that you may have a physical condition or illness. It is important to understand that fever is not a disease by itself.

Fever is a phenomenon that occurs when the immune system detects a threat, usually a virus or bacteria .

It is expressed as a fever when a person's body temperature exceeds 37.5°C. However, it is when your body temperature reaches 41°C or higher that requires immediate action. When the fever is not severe, it is not necessary to take action as the heat will naturally drop after a few hours. That said, it's a good idea to consider lowering your fever with natural remedies.

Fever is usually accompanied by chills and discomfort. That's why it's so important to take steps to make the fever cool down faster.

Take a shower

Make sure your body doesn't feel any sudden changes in temperature. Therefore, it is better to take a shower with warm or lukewarm water to lower the heat .

Wrap your ankle

Wrapping your ankles with wet socks can help normalize your body temperature more quickly. You can also apply a damp cloth to your forehead, knees, or elbows.

Take a break

The body needs additional energy to fight pathogens that generate heat So, it's best to rest until you feel better.

Replenish enough moisture

Dehydration is another symptom of fever. Drink water, juice or soup to prevent dehydration .

Eat lightly

Don't eat heavy meals when you have a fever. Vegetable porridge or soup will soothe your hunger while your body recovers.
